Immerse yourself in the enchanting world of Franz Schubert with his captivating collection of Impromptus, Op. 90 D. 899 & Op. 142 D. 935. Released on January 1, 2009, under the Zig-Zag Territoires label, this album is a testament to Schubert's mastery of chamber music and classical piano compositions. Spanning a total duration of 1 hour and 5 minutes, the album features eight impromptus, each a unique blend of technical brilliance and emotional depth.
The album opens with the impromptus from Op. 90 D. 899, starting with the dramatic and introspective No. 1 in C Minor, followed by the lively and spirited No. 2 in E Flat Major. The third impromptu, in G-Flat Major, offers a more contemplative and serene atmosphere, while the fourth in A-Flat Major concludes the set with a playful and energetic Allegretto.
The second set of impromptus, Op. 142 D. 935, begins with the brooding and intense No. 1 in F Minor, followed by the graceful and elegant No. 2 in A-Flat Major. The third impromptu, in B-Flat Major, is a gentle and lyrical piece, while the final No. 4 in F Minor brings the album to a close with a lively and humorous Allegro scherzando.
